Role As a supervisor, you will manage a diverse portfolio of repair jobs that vary in scale and complexity, across both residential and commercial insurance reinstatement projects. Your responsibilities will include: Engaging trades and monitoring progress Forecasting monthly revenue according to project completion dates Compile and deliver detailed scope of works Compile and deliver accurate budget breakdowns, to allow successful tender results and profitable delivery of construction works Plan, schedule and drive multiple small to medium domestic and commercial construction repairs Ensure trades/suppliers adhere to purchase orders, SOW's and quote requests Quality assurance and client liaison Managing budgets resulting in the delivery of quality outcomes for clients Working with the Procurement team to onboard and manage subcontractors and suppliers Have a detailed understanding and experience in the construction process, critical inspection points, permit requirements and WHS requirements Provide accurate progress updates for internal and external use. Skills and Qualifications To secure an opportunity we are seeking candidates who meet the following; Supervision experience in medium to large, domestic and commercial construction repairs Proven skills in construction estimating for building repairs to both domestic and commercial properties Experience working directly with clients, building consultants, and all construction related trades and suppliers Ability to deal with multiple projects simultaneously with conflicting priorities. Strong verbal and written communication. Experience in the insurance repair industry is beneficial Thorough understanding the construction process, critical inspection points, permit and WHS requirements Understanding of relevant Building codes and Australian standards.
